Recognition and population of form fields in an electronic document

    公开(公告)号:US10223344B2

    公开(公告)日:2019-03-05

    申请号:US14605475

    申请日:2015-01-26

    Applicant: Adobe Inc.

    Abstract: Techniques are disclosed for identifying and populating static form fields using prior responses to similar form fields. An example method includes receiving an electronic form having, encoded in the form, static text and a static form field for containing information specific to a given user of the electronic form. Using an image recognition algorithm, a fillable form field candidate is identified based on a graphical representation of the static form field. An attribute of the fillable form field candidate can be identified based on the static text. A suggested response for populating the fillable form field candidate is selected from prior responses to other form fields having at least one attribute in common with the identified attribute of the fillable form field candidate. The prior responses are inputs obtained from or associated with the given user. The suggested response is presented to the user for subsequent acceptance or rejection.

    Proactive form guidance for interacting with electronic forms

    公开(公告)号:US10657200B2

    公开(公告)日:2020-05-19

    申请号:US14988044

    申请日:2016-01-05

    Applicant: Adobe Inc.

    Abstract: Techniques for guiding an interaction with an electronic form via a computing device are described. For example, a form guidance engine is initiated. The form guidance engine maintains a state of the electronic form. The form guidance engine also maintains user information in, for example, a user profile. The user information is associated with a user of the computing device and relates to how the user interacts with the electronic form. Based on the user information, the form guidance engine anticipates a potential interaction with the electronic form given the state. Accordingly and prior to a user request for information about the electronic form, the form guidance engine generates a presentation configured to guide the user to perform the potential interaction with the electronic form via a computing device. A user response to the presentation is received. The form guidance engine performs an action associated with the electronic form and updates the state of the electronic form.

    Removal of background information from digital images

    公开(公告)号:US10332262B2

    公开(公告)日:2019-06-25

    申请号:US15435252

    申请日:2017-02-16

    Applicant: Adobe Inc.

    Abstract: Computerized methods and systems remove background information from digitally encoded images. A digitally encoded image is retrieved and converted to greyscale if it is encoded as a color image. The greyscale image is divided into a first set of subsections. The first set of subsections is processed to individually remove any background portions from each subsection of the first set of subsections. The greyscale image may also be divided into a second set of subsections and the second set of subsections is processed to individually remove any background portions from each subsection of the second set of subsections containing contours. The first set of subsections and second set of subsections may be merged to create a new version of the image, and the new version of the image is stored to digital storage.
